Energy recovery from waste is important in the development of sustainable energy policies. EPA continues to develop regulations that encourage energy recovery from hazardous materials or materials that might otherwise be disposed of as solid waste. The non-hazardous secondary material NHSM final rule under the Resource Conservation and Recovery Act RCRA identifies which non-hazardous secondary materials are, or are not, solid wastes when burned in combustion units.

This determines which Clean Air Act emission standards a combustion unit is required to meet. Gasification is a process that converts any material containing carbon—such as coal, petroleum or biomass—into synthesis gas syngas composed of hydrogen and carbon monoxide. The syngas can then be burned to produce electricity or further processed to produce vehicle fuel. Waste minimization, the term employed in the RCRA statute, is defined to include both source reduction and certain types of environmentally sound recycling.

EPA's highest priority is to achieve reductions through source reduction. However, if this is not achievable, then environmentally sound recycling is also an Agency priority. Recycling activities closely resembling conventional waste treatment activities such as burning for energy recovery do not constitute waste minimization. Also, treatment for the purposes of destruction or disposal is not part of waste minimization, but is, rather, an activity that occurs after the opportunities for waste minimization have been pursued.

Energy Recovery from Combustion Energy recovery from the combustion of municipal solid waste is a key part of the non-hazardous waste management hierarchy , which ranks various management strategies from most to least environmentally preferred.

Combustion Technologies Common technologies for the combustion of MSW include mass burn facilities, modular systems and refuse derived fuel systems. Mass Burn Facilities Mass burn facilities are the most common type of combustion facility in the United States.
